What you will be doing:
+ In this position, you will research and develop techniques to GPU accelerate workloads in deep learning, machine learning or other AI domains.
+ Work directly with other technical experts in their fields (industry and academia) to perform in-depth analysis and optimization of complex AI and HPC algorithms to ensure optimal AI solutions on modern CPU and GPU architectures.
+ Publish and/or present discovered optimization techniques in developer blogs or relevant conferences to engage and educate the developer community.
+ Influence the design of next-generation hardware architectures, software, and programming models in collaboration with research, hardware, system software, libraries, and tools teams at NVIDIA.      
What we need to see:
+ Currently pursuing a PhD or Master degree in Computer Science, Computer Engineering, or related computationally focused science degree.
+ Programming fluency in C/C++ with a deep understanding of algorithms and software development.
+ A background that includes parallel programming, e.g., CUDA, OpenACC, OpenMP, MPI, pthreads, etc.
+ Effective communication and organization skills, with a logical approach to problem solving, good time management, and prioritization skills.      
Ways to stand out from the crowd:
+ Expertise in parallelization and performance optimization of Deep Learning models arising from Natural Language Processing, Computer Vision, Recommender Systems, etc.
+ Excellent understanding of linear algebra.
